Tiger marking the tree

Species: Panthera tigris, Bengal Tiger | Location: Bandhavgarh National Park/Reserve, India

Tiger marking a tree with scent glands in its pads of the paws. It was late in the evening just as were returning to park exit and we were fortunate enough to see this magnificent creature that did not seem to care that we were close by.
